Quick Chinese Beef and Broccoli Meal


  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Description

A speedy and flavorful stir-fry featuring tender beef slices and crisp broccoli in a savory sauce, perfect for weeknight dinners.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b flank steak or sirloin, thinly sliced
  • 4 cups broccoli florets
  • 1/3 cup soy sauce (low-sodium if preferred)
  • 2 tbsp oyster sauce
  • 1/2 cup beef broth
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tbsp fresh ginger, grated
  • 2 tbsp cornstarch
  • 12 tsp brown sugar (optional)
  • 23 tbsp vegetable oil
  • 1 tsp sesame oil
  • Rice or noodles, for serving

  • Instructions

    1. Slice beef thinly against the grain and marinate with 1 tbsp soy sauce, 1 tsp cornstarch, and 1 tsp oil for 15 minutes.

    2. Bring a pot of water to a boil, blanch broccoli for 1 minute until bright green, then immediately rinse with cold water and drain.

    3. In a bowl, whisk together remaining soy sauce, oyster sauce, beef broth, cornstarch slurry (1 tbsp cornstarch mixed with 2 tbsp water), brown sugar, and sesame oil.

    4. Heat 2 tbsp vegetable oil in a wok or large skillet over high heat. Stir-fry beef in batches for 2–3 minutes until just cooked, then remove and set aside.

    5. Add garlic and ginger to the wok and stir-fry for 30 seconds until fragrant.

    6. Return beef and broccoli to the wok, pour in the sauce, and cook for 2–3 minutes until sauce thickens and coats all ingredients.

    7. Serve hot over steamed rice or noodles.
